What is Ocean Acidification?
Ocean acidification occurs when seawater absorbs excess carbon dioxide (CO₂) from the atmosphere, leading to a chemical change that lowers pH levels. This phenomenon threatens marine ecosystems and biodiversity. 🌊🧪
Key Impacts on Marine Life
- Coral Reefs: Acidification weakens coral skeletons, jeopardizing reef ecosystems. 🐠
- Shellfish: Organisms like oyster and plankton struggle to build shells. 🌿
- Fish Behavior: Altered pH levels may disrupt fish sensory and reproductive functions. 🐟
Global Policy Measures
Governments and organizations are implementing strategies to mitigate ocean acidification:
- Reduce CO₂ Emissions: Promote renewable energy and carbon capture technologies.
- Marine Protected Areas: Expand zones to safeguard vulnerable species. 🛡️
- International Collaboration: Share research and set global emission targets.
